  • Apalachicola Farmers Market

    Located at 133 Avenue E, across from CVS, the Apalachicola Farmers Market offers local seafood, produce, honey, homemade breads, pies, and other regional specialties every 2nd and 4th Saturday from 9 AM until 1 PM in Apalachicola.
